Aunt Pat's Cheese Ball Recipe

Ingredients:

8 oz. cream cheese, room temperature
1 c. sharp cheddar cheese, grated
1 tin flakey ham (Deviled Ham)
1/2 c. dill pickles, minced or sweet Yum, Yums
2 T. mayonnaise
1 tsp. Worcestershire sauce
1/2 c. chopped nuts
2 T. parsley

Directions:

Mix first 6 ingredients until smooth. Cover and chill until firm. Shape into a ball and roll into the nuts and parsley. Serve with crackers.
